Living in Wooster OH

Apartments for rent in Wooster, OH offer access to a historic college town established in 1808 and named after American Revolutionary War general David Wooster. Located in northeastern Ohio's Wayne County, Wooster combines educational institutions with a strong manufacturing presence.

The rental market in Wooster features average rents starting around $832 for one-bedroom apartments and $1,161 for two-bedroom units. Housing options are available near the College of Wooster campus, known for its distinctive Kauke Hall, and throughout the downtown area where East Liberty Street showcases historic architecture. Apartment communities and townhomes are distributed across residential neighborhoods.

The city spans 17 square miles and features Wooster Memorial Park, home to seven miles of hiking trails, and Christmas Run Park, which includes recreational facilities.

Wooster's economy centers on education and manufacturing, anchored by the College of Wooster, Ohio State University's Agricultural Technical Institute, and the Ohio Agricultural Research and Development Center. Corporate headquarters include Buehler Food Markets, Wooster Brush, Seaman Corp., and Certified Angus Beef. Located approximately 50 miles from Cleveland, 35 miles from Akron, and 30 miles from Canton, Wooster provides access to major metropolitan areas while maintaining its small-town atmosphere.
